Farmers Union News LIBERTY A resolution thst cooperative warehouse certificates of Interest be paid in whole or in part, by cash was passed st the meeting of Liberty Fsrmer's un ion local Tuesdsy night. The reso lution Is to be presented to the warehouse board of directors. Heretofore, warehouse purchase dividends have been Issued as certificates of interest snd it is desired now thst dividends be issued in cssh, either entirely or in, psrt. John Dssch, president, report ed on the recent session of county local presidents and secretarys and the discussions pertaining to increasing; attendance and Inter est in Farmer's union locals. Dis cussion wss continued here on the subject. It was voted to have a commit tee appointed to see about the purchase of silverware as It was decided also to have two meet ings a month. Mrs. Roy Farrand, Mrs. John VanLoh and Mrs. E. G. Clark were appointed to arrange date of second meeting. John Van Loh and Frank Me Cauley were voted Into member ship and given the obligation by Frank Judd, secretary.
